Avaz Yuldoshev

DUSHANBE, August 26, 2011, Asia-Plus  — On Thursday August 25, Foreign Minister Hamrokhon Zarifi received a delegation of the European Union for international relations, led by Professor Anton Caragea, Director of the European Council on International Relations (ECIR), according to the Tajik MFA information department.

In the course of the talks, Professor Caragea reportedly expressed gratitude for organization of the visit of the delegation and noted the importance of awarding the Leader of XXI Century Award to President Emomali Rahmon.

During the meeting, Zarifi and Caragea also exchanged views on expansion of cooperation between Tajikistan and the European Council.  They also considered issues related to bilateral cooperation between Tajikistan and Romania.

Representative of the delegation of the European Council informed Tajik minister of an experience of Romania in developing hydropower engineering and offered to establish bilateral cooperation in that area, the source added.
